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ines
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.
REPEAT: Do NOT report bugs for outdated packages!
https://wiki.archlinux.org/title/Bug_reporting_guidelines
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.
REPEAT: Do NOT report bugs for outdated packages!
FS#80339 - [glslang] spirv-tools should also be a runtime dependency
Attached to Project:
Arch Linux
Opened by q rty (q234rty) - Friday, 24 November 2023, 04:22 GMT
Last edited by Daurnimator (daurnimator) - Friday, 24 November 2023, 05:06 GMT
Opened by q rty (q234rty) - Friday, 24 November 2023, 04:22 GMT
Last edited by Daurnimator (daurnimator) - Friday, 24 November 2023, 05:06 GMT
|
DetailsDescription:
After https://gitlab.archlinux.org/archlinux/packaging/packages/glslang/-/commit/1ef1edf2a2c96d95b9fbaf898540800aa6b22409, spriv-tools seems to be needed at runtime for the glslang binary. Additional info: glslang 13.1.1 spirv-tools 2023.5-1 Steps to reproduce: $ LC_ALL=C readelf -d /usr/bin/glslang Dynamic section at offset 0x2a8840 contains 27 entries: Tag Type Name/Value 0x0000000000000001 (NEEDED) Shared library: [libSPIRV-Tools-opt.so] 0x0000000000000001 (NEEDED) Shared library: [libSPIRV-Tools.so] 0x0000000000000001 (NEEDED) Shared library: [libstdc++.so.6] 0x0000000000000001 (NEEDED) Shared library: [libm.so.6] 0x0000000000000001 (NEEDED) Shared library: [libc.so.6] |
This task depends upon
glslang W: Referenced library 'libSPIRV-Tools.so' is an uninstalled dependency (needed in files ['usr/bin/glslang', 'usr/lib/libSPIRV.so.13.1.1'])
glslang W: Referenced library 'libSPIRV-Tools-opt.so' is an uninstalled dependency (needed in files ['usr/bin/glslang', 'usr/lib/libSPIRV.so.13.1.1'])